If what you mean by interchangable is that it will fit an fire...
The answer is a probable yes. The sideplate is one of the many parts that should be fitted to the frame for a solid fit, but in general (and I don't mean General DWM Ted!), the sideplate should fit well enough to function. If it doesn't, and it came from another one of you guns, don't modify it to fit... Get a diffent sideplate to fit on to your shooter.
